Badal raj

United States

Review about Meteors Immigration Consultancy Services
meteors Immigration consultancy is an exceptionally proficient and submitted movement organization from Delhi, India. The colleagues at Meteors are straightforward and true with their work. Before a few months, I was searching for an examination visa in Canada.